Global Employment Practices Liability Insurance Market size was valued at USD 4.79 Billion in 2024 and is poised to grow from USD 5.21 Billion in 2025 to USD 10.23 Billion by 2033, growing at a CAGR of 8.8% during the forecast period (2026-2033).
The Global Employment Practices Liability Insurance (EPLI) market is experiencing significant growth driven by heightened awareness of workplace risks, a rising number of lawsuits related to wrongful termination, discrimination, and harassment, and the adoption of compliance-focused risk management strategies. Strong demand is notably observed in North America due to high legal costs and strict regulations, closely followed by Europe, where companies seek EPLI coverage to mitigate reputational and regulatory risks amid changing labor laws. The Asia-Pacific region stands out for its rapid growth, propelled by increased workplace diversity and the strengthening of employment rights. Insurers are innovating with modular coverage options and utilizing online platforms for efficient claim processing, while small and medium enterprises emerge as a crucial demand segment, highlighting the need for tailored EPLI solutions.

Driver of the Global Employment Practices Liability Insurance Market
The dynamic social landscape and heightened awareness surrounding labor rights contribute significantly to a rising number of claims related to discrimination, harassment, and wrongful termination. As new protected classes emerge and legal frameworks evolve, the complexities of employment law become increasingly intricate. This constant evolution not only shapes the way organizations manage workplace relations but also intensifies the demand for coverage against potential employment-related claims. Consequently, these factors drive the expansion of the global employment practices liability insurance market, as businesses seek to safeguard themselves from the financial repercussions associated with compliance failures and employee grievances.
Restraints in the Global Employment Practices Liability Insurance Market
The global employment practices liability insurance market faces significant challenges due to an increase in the frequency and severity of claims. Insurers have responded by implementing stricter underwriting criteria, raising deductibles, and increasing premiums, creating a more rigid market environment. As a result, companies, particularly those in higher-risk sectors, are encountering rising costs and elevated self-insured retention levels during policy renewals. This tightening of market conditions restricts the growth potential of the employment practices liability insurance industry, making it increasingly difficult for businesses to secure affordable coverage while managing their associated risks effectively.
Market Trends of the Global Employment Practices Liability Insurance Market
The Global Employment Practices Liability Insurance (EPLI) market is witnessing a pronounced trend driven by a surge in wage and hour litigation. This growing concern encompasses issues related to unpaid overtime, employee misclassification, and meal break claims, which frequently result in costly class-action lawsuits. Additionally, the classification of remote workers and gig economy participants has emerged as a significant source of legal disputes, further amplifying the demand for comprehensive coverage. As businesses navigate an increasingly complex regulatory landscape and heightened litigation risks, the EPLI market is expanding to address these challenges, ensuring organizations are better protected against potential liabilities associated with employment practices.
